Built for Every Body: Sandrine Hebert Pelletier of VIBE Lounge

Some people build bodies.
Sandrine Hebert Pelletier is building something more: trust, confidence, and a space where people feel seen.

I’ve known Sandrine for about three years, since I started training at Vibe Lounge, the studio she co-founded with her partner, Arad Seyedin. At first, I joined their group sessions alongside the Last Drop crew. But as I got more serious, I moved into personal training. Over time, I saw something rare—a gym that wasn’t about pushing people to their limits, but about understanding people from the inside out.

Whether you’re an elite athlete or someone just starting, Sandrine makes you feel like you belong. That’s not marketing—it’s how she actually moves through the room. It’s in the way she asks how you’re feeling before every session, or adjusts your plan on the fly if something’s off. And it’s in the way she’s consistently stayed curious and humble, always learning, always adapting.

Now, my partner Anisa trains with her too. Because when you find people who care like this, you stay close.


The Path to Purpose

Sandrine didn’t always know she wanted to work in fitness. In fact, she tried a lot of things first—makeup school, fashion, business—until something clicked.

“It wasn’t until I started working with a personal trainer that I realized I was passionate about learning and teaching movement.”

That realization didn’t lead to a quick answer. But it sparked a search. And eventually, she made a decision most people would never have the clarity or courage to make:

“I couldn’t find the kind of gym I was looking for… so I created it.”


A Mindset Built on Reps

What makes Vibe Lounge different isn’t just the programming or equipment. It’s the philosophy. No two clients get the same plan. And no session is treated like a job to finish—it’s a relationship to build.

“It might sound obvious, but a strong body is built through daily reps.
And when you become stronger physically, your mindset usually follows.”

That mindset shapes everything Sandrine touches, from her group coaching sessions to the way she mentors clients through injury recovery, hormonal changes, stress, or even just low-energy days. She meets you where you are, and then walks with you until you’re stronger.


Progress with a Beginner’s Mind

Sandrine’s not just a trainer, she’s a student too. She reads, tests, and integrates new practices constantly. You’ll often find her researching new tools, experimenting with new recovery devices, or diving into the neuroscience of movement.

“Progress is about keeping a beginner’s mindset.
There’s always more to learn.”

She’s also become a powerful voice in the space, growing her personal platform, sharing stories, and emerging as someone with a lot more to say in this space. And she’s just getting started.


Built With Care

One of the most impressive things about Sandrine is that she built Vibe Lounge with her partner, Arad. Anyone who’s ever worked with a partner knows the difficulty of separating roles, giving each other space, and still moving forward with shared vision.

They’ve done it all, coaching, managing, building a brand, and mentoring a team. And through all of it, they’ve remained open, warm, and focused. You don’t walk into Vibe and feel tension. You feel alignment.

That energy is intentional. It’s been shaped rep by rep.

The Middle of the Journey

Sandrine’s not at the finish line, and she’s not rushing to get there. She’s in the middle, refining, learning, and growing with every session and every client.

“Coming home after a long day and knowing you’ve taken even one step toward your goals…
That’s the most fulfilling part of the journey.”

If she could whisper something to someone just starting?

“Don’t be scared to ask for help.
People who are passionate about what they do love helping others do the same.”

That’s what she’s doing now. Helping people become stronger, more grounded, more confident—one movement, one mindset shift at a time.
